SYRACUSE — A leader of the Export-Import Bank of the United States will deliver the keynote address at the CenterState CEO annual meeting in April.
Wanda Felton, first vice president and vice chairwoman of the bank, will provide an outlook on the growth of potential U.S. exports and discuss international opportunities for companies in the region. Representatives from the Brookings Institution will also be present to discuss a new strategy to increase regional exports.
Central New York is one of four areas in the nation participating in the Brookings Metropolitan Export Initiative. The goal is to provide blueprints that can be followed in metropolitan areas around the country to double exports over five years.

“It’s never been more important than it is now for local businesses to seek out new markets for growth,” CenterState CEO President Robert Simpson said in a news release.
CenterState CEO will also announce its Business of the Year award winners and the winner of the $200,000 Creative Core Emerging Business Competition.
